Bike Buses, a fun solution for cycling to York schools. A York Climate Commission event.

Join us for an exciting online event where we learn from the Green Schools Project and Sustrans about the benefits of Bike Buses for fun active travel to schools . Learn about how this innovative concept can make cycling to school safe, fun, and eco-friendly. Whether you're a student, parent, or educator, this event is perfect for anyone interested in promoting safe sustainable travel options. Don't miss out on this informative session!

Frequently asked questions

Will there be a chance to ask questions?

Yes! This is a practical session to share good practice and help parents to understand what a Bike Bus could mean for safer cycling options for the school run. We will share the Sustrans toolkit of resources.

If I cant attend can I still find out more?

Yes. The Transport group of the York Climate Commission meets monthly and is keen to support positive green transport solutions in York. Please get in touch for more details

Who are the presenters?

Loz Hennessy is Community Climate Action Manager for Green Schools Project and Joe Wood is a Yr6 teacher at May Park Primary School which started a Bike Bus in Bristol
